Hydro-Jet Service: This is the process of using a flow of high pressured water to clean the inside surface of a pipe, removing anything that may build up over time and cause a clog. While hydro jetting is great for clearing backups and clogged sewer lines, it is more beneficial to use hydro jetting as a preventive measure to hopefully avoid those costly backups.

Clogged Drains FAQs

How do I know if my sink is clogged?

There are several signs that your sink may be clogged. The most obvious sign is it will not drain at all or is very slow to drain. Also, if there are bad odors coming from the drain, this might be a sign that something is stuck in there. Additionally, if your drain is making strange noises, you need to call us so we can unclog it.

Why does my bathroom drain keep getting clogged?

It is not uncommon for bathtub or shower drains to get clogged often. Dirt, skin residue, and hair will bind to soap scum will combine to create gunk. Then it easily binds to the walls of the pipes. Overtime, water will be unable to pass through the pipes. The shower tub or bathtub will begin to backup. If this is a common problem, we can fix it!

How do I prevent my bathtub from clogging?

Keeping your drains clear of debris can be tricky, however there are a few things you can do to prevent it. In your shower, we suggest purchasing a cover for the drain (commonly called hair catchers) that will collect large debris like clumps of hair. After each use, you should clean it out to prevent it form doing down the drain. This may not stop all of it, but it will definitely stop the majority.

How do I prevent my kitchen sink from clogging?

The keeping your kitchen sink can be tricky. It is the most common cause of major backups in households. There are a few basic things you should do to prevent it. If you have a garbage disposal, you have to use it properly. We highly suggest following the recommendations from the disposal manufactures. Simply not disposing of certain items will save you a lot of time and money with a clogged kitchen sink. Additionally, you should never dump grease of any kind down the sink and never use harsh cleaners. And, as always, use a mesh or metal drain strainer to catch all debris while you are washing dishes.
